We have lost the ability to distinguish between actual news, propaganda, and commentary. A journalist will of course have opinions and preferences but must be able to set them aside and report the facts - just as they are - whether he likes them or not. Journalists have sources not friends. You are not a journalist if you are so enmeshed with one political party that not only will a lobbyist recognize you can give them access to party leaders but you yourself recognize you can comfortably act as a go between for lobbyists even assuring them it “is not problem” for you to carry their messages to party leaders (Radia Tapes). Barkha Dutt is not a political journalist; she is a political commentator for the most part and a political propagandist on occasion.
